npm 包 node-opcua-service-translate-browse-path 使用教程

阅读时长 4 分钟读完

前言

在前端开发中,我们经常需要访问服务器上的 OPC UA(Open Platform Communications Unified Architecture)数据。而在实际开发中,我们需要使用不同的编程语言以及框架来实现不同的功能。此时,我们可以使用 npm 包来快速地解决问题。在本文中,我们将重点介绍一个 npm 包:node-opcua-service-translate-browse-path。

简介

node-opcua-service-translate-browse-path 是一个 OPC UA 规范中的服务,用于在节点之间进行导航。它基于 Node.js 平台,可以帮助开发者快速地访问 OPC UA 服务器上的数据。

该 npm 包的主要功能:

  • 提供了一种简洁而高效的方法来访问 OPC UA 服务器上的数据;
  • 能够根据节点的路径提供导航服务,帮助用户更加方便地访问服务器上的数据;
  • 支持多种编程语言以及框架,方便开发者进行编程。

安装

可以通过以下命令安装 node-opcua-service-translate-browse-path:

使用示例

下面是一个基本的使用示例:

-- -------------------- ---- -------
----- ----- - ----------------------
----- ------------------- - ----------------------------------------------------

----- ------ - --- --------------------
----- ----------- - ------------------------------

------ -------- -- -

    --- -

        -- -- --- -- ---
        ----- ----------------------------

        ----- ------- - ----- -----------------------

        -- ----
        ----- ---------- - --- -----------------------------------------------------------
            ----------- -
                -- -------
                --- ---------------------------------
                    ------------- ------------------------------------------
                    ----------- ---------------------------------------------------
                --
            -
        ---

        ----- ------ - ----- ----------------------------------------

        --------------------

    - ----- ----- -
        -------------------
    -

    ----- --------------------

-----

注意:该示例假设 OPC UA 服务器的地址是 "opc.tcp://192.168.1.1:51145",且该服务器有名为 "MyDevice" 的节点,并且该节点下有名为 "Python" 的子节点。

总结

本文简要介绍了一个 npm 包:node-opcua-service-translate-browse-path。该包提供了一种简单而高效的方法来访问 OPC UA 服务器上的数据,并且支持多种编程语言以及框架。本文还提供了一个简单的示例来演示如何使用该 npm 包。希望本文能够对广大前端开发者有所帮助。

来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/65055

纠错
反馈